  7. Anonymous users2024-02-10

    Of course, fried cauliflower is blanched before it tastes good.

    First, cut the cauliflower into pieces, then wash the cauliflower twice with running water and set aside. The cauliflower must not be cut too large, otherwise it will be difficult to absorb the flavor, and do not cut too small, otherwise it will have no texture when eaten. Put an appropriate amount of water in the pot, boil the water, put the cauliflower and a little salt into the pot, boil the cauliflower for 40 seconds on high heat, then remove it, and then put the cauliflower into cold water and soak it for 3 minutes to set aside.

    After the pot is heated, put in an appropriate amount of oil, when the oil temperature is 7 hot, put the minced ginger, minced garlic, green pepper slices, and red pepper slices into the pot and stir-fry, then put the cauliflower and salt into the pot, and fry for 20 seconds. Add a little hot water along the edge of the pot, and finally put all the dark soy sauce, chicken essence and pepper into the pot, and continue to stir-fry for 20 seconds before serving.

    Why blanch first.

    When frying cauliflower, you need to blanch the cauliflower, because the maximum temperature of the water is 100 degrees Celsius, and the maximum temperature of the oil is 300 degrees Celsius.

    When blanching cauliflower, you need to put a little salt, because when boiling cauliflower, salt molecules will quickly enter every part of the cauliflower, so that the fried cauliflower will taste more delicious. After blanching, the cauliflower needs to be put into cold water immediately to cool down, which can prevent the cauliflower from becoming soft due to excessive residual temperature, and directly put the cauliflower into cold water to cool down, which can ensure the crisp and tender feeling of the cauliflower.

  9. Anonymous users2024-02-08

    When the cauliflower is fried, it needs to be blanched. Before blanching, divide the cauliflower into large flowers, put it in clean water, add an appropriate amount of salt and stir well, and soak for more than 10 minutes, so that the small insects hidden in the cauliflower can be soaked, and some pesticide residues can also be removed. The reason for soaking in large flowers is to prevent more nutrients from being lost.

    After soaking, remove the cauliflower, continue to divide it into medium potato florets, and at the same time boil the water, ready to blanch the cauliflower.

    Blanching techniques. When blanching leafy greens, they like to add a little salt or a few drops of oil to the water, which can keep the color of the vegetables beautiful emerald green. But when blanching the cauliflower, you don't need to add salt or oil, just pour it into hot water and blanch it.

    After the water is boiling, pour in the milk, add a few drops of rice vinegar (you can replace it with other white vinegar), and then pour in the cauliflower and blanch for about 30 seconds. Because it has to be fried in the pot later, the cauliflower can not be blanched too much, and it will be out of the pot immediately when it is seven or eight ripe, and quickly scooped into cold water to cool down, which is the key operation to make the cauliflower taste crisp and tender.
